In this edition of restaurant “concepts to watch,” we highlight three restaurant concepts that are making an impact on Canadian diners this October. Here’s a look at the characteristics and menu offerings that make these restaurants unique:

Shawarma Palace

Restaurant concepts: Shawarma Palace

Facebook: 1,513 likes | Instagram: 282 followers

Locations: 4 (Calgary and Airdrie, Alberta)

Concept characteristics:

  • Family-owned restaurants serving fresh and health-forward Mediterranean fare
  • Three units in Calgary and one in Airdrie; stores in Calgary are located in the Forest Lawn, Falconridge and Montgomery neighbourhoods
  • All units are open daily from late-morning to late-night hours
  • Delivery available through third-party apps, Uber Eats and DoorDash

Menu snapshot:

  • Wraps and platters — mostly meat-heavy, spotlighting varieties such as Chicken; Beef Donair; Chicken and Beef Donair; and Chicken, Lamb and Beef
  • Sides — feature falafel, hummus, baked garlic potatoes, rice, samosa and grape leaves
  • Salads — chicken and tabbouleh varieties available
  • Desserts — baklava spotlighted as main dessert option

Burger de Ville

Restaurant concepts - Burger de Ville

Facebook: 8,671 likes | Instagram: 1,028 followers

Locations: 3 (Montreal)

Concept characteristics:

  • Gourmet burger shops with a focus on fresh offerings at affordable prices
  • Founded by father-son duo Mohamed and Reda Wahba
  • Stores emphasize a casual and relaxed family atmosphere
  • Delivery offered through third-party apps Uber Eats and SkipTheDishes

Menu snapshot:

  • Burgers—varieties include Black & Blue, featuring blue cheese; Saint, made with harissa mayonnaise; and Mediterranean, featuring grilled veggies and goat cheese
  • Entrees—baby back ribs, grilled chicken and beef steaks
  • Sides—selections include grilled veggies, spicy fries, coleslaw and soup of the day
  • Poutines—varieties spotlight Tex Mex, Porto and Old Fashioned

Anejo Restaurant

restaurant concepts

Facebook: 6,798 likes | Instagram: 18,135 followers

Locations: 2 (Toronto and Calgary, Alberta)

Concept characteristics:

  • Artsy Mexican restaurants
  • Warm and laidback atmosphere achieved by vibrant decor, including colourful art and brick walls
  • Calgary store is in the landmark 4th Street Rose building and features a multilevel, sky-lit room
  • Reservations accepted and capacity to hold private events available

Menu snapshot:

  • Snacks—highlight tuna poke, stuffed jalapenos, guacamole with tortilla chips, ginger coconut prawns and ceviche
  • Plates—spotlight enchiladas; skirt steak with asparagus; Spanish rice with chicken; and beef, vegetarian and seafood varieties of molcajetes
  • Tacos—made with beef, pork, tilapia, chicken, chorizo or mushroom, and fillings include red cabbage, cilantro, onion and jalapeno
  • Tequila-focused bar—touts 200+ varieties of tequila including blanco (white), reposado (rested), anejo (aged) and extra anejo (extra aged)
